Ticket #4412: Signature verification failed on the Quillbranch agent build after last night's leaked-file-descriptor hunt. The fd audit tool held the manifest open during signing, so the digest changed mid-run. Rerun the signer after confirming the audit daemon is stopped. Support should verify the rebuilt artifact against the staging keyring using the key below.

release key, yagap-kagag: bky6_1ks93y

Branch managers: heads-up that we're in early talks to acquire Fennick Tooling, a small outfit whose kit overlaps nicely with our Ridgeway service line. Nothing is signed, and frankly it could still fall over on valuation. If it proceeds, integration would start next quarter with minimal disruption to branch operations — mainly new catalogue items and some cross-training. Please don't mention this to suppliers or customers; rumours will spook Fennick's staff. Questions go to Marla Deen only. The confidential outline of the plan sits below.

confidential, kagup-bafog: Fraaxax Group is in early talks to buy Soroxox Group for about $343.8 million. The Olidor launch date is June 14, and nothing goes to the press before then. Legal wants the Aldmirek Logistics term sheet signed before July 23.

## Configuration

Plugins built against PixelRinse must declare which EXIF fields they scrub and which they preserve. Set PIXELRINSE_PRESERVE_FIELDS to a comma-separated allowlist (orientation is kept by default), and PIXELRINSE_STRICT=true to reject images with unknown maker notes. Plugin authors receive a signing credential from the Rinseworks registry so the host can verify your scrub manifests. Place that credential in your plugin's `.env` on the line that follows.

sealed setting: ARCHIVE_KEY3=8d0

## Step 4: Enable payload compression

Before promoting build 7.2 of Lanternfall to staging, switch the telemetry agent to compressed payloads. The collector on Veylight Hub accepts zstd as of this release, and uncompressed traffic will be rejected after the cutover window. Update each edge node's agent config, restart the telemetry daemon, and verify ingest counters stay flat for ten minutes. Apply the following settings to every node in the fleet:

settings of bafog-bagug:
druwyn:
  pin: 2480
  metrics_host: metrics.druwyn.tolvaqlabs.internal
  tenant: ulaath
  seal: seal_26cd47c5